The best time to worship, celebrate, and receive blessings of Goddess Durga. This Navratri, which comes in Ashwin month, is called the Shardiya Navratri. The peculiarity of this Navratri is that we worship Goddess Bhagwati by setting up an urn in the houses as well as in the Pooja Pandals.

Astrologer Diwakar Tripathi, director, Institute of Upliftment Astrology, has said that the Shardiya Navratri is starting on the 17th of October. On the date, the first form of Goddess, Maa Shail Putri is a very important day. Ghat Stapna will take place on this day. It is best to set up an urn or any auspicious work done in the auspicious Muhurat and date. Therefore, it is very important to consider the auspicious Muhurat for Ghat Stapna on this day.

Abhijit Muhurat is considered to be auspicious for starting new things. Abhijit Muhurat starts at 11:36 and ends at 12:24. It is considered bad to do the Ghat Stapna in the Chitra Nakshatra. Thus, Chitra Nakshatra will end after 2:20 pm, after which Ghat Stapna can be done.

Kumbh Nakshatra will start at 2:30 pm to 3:55 pm and will also have a good chowghadia at this time.  So, this time is excellent for Ghat Stapna. Another Muhurat will start at 07:06 to 09:02 pm at night, but in the meantime, Chowghadia is auspicious from 07:30, so Ghat Stapna can be done at 07:08.
